Supplementary information

This supplementary information is collated from multiple sources and compiled automatically.

The protein GAS41 also known as Glioma-Amplified Sequence 41 weighs approximately 26 kDa. It is ubiquitously expressed in various cell types including brain and neuronal tissues. GAS41 performs as a component of the chromatin remodeling complex. This protein participates in DNA binding and potentially regulates transcription processes influencing gene expression patterns.
Biological function summary

GAS41 impacts cellular proliferation and organization. It is often part of the Tip60/NuA4 histone acetyltransferase complex which is involved in chromatin modification. Through its role in this complex GAS41 influences transcriptional regulation by modifying chromatin architecture. This process ultimately affects how genes are turned on or off in cells which is key for maintaining cellular function and identity.

Pathways

GAS41 plays a significant role in the regulation of gene expression pathways and cell cycle control. It interacts with proteins in the SWI/SNF-related chromatin remodeler pathways and modulates how genes involved in cell cycle progression are expressed. GAS41 shows interaction with proteins like p400 which also contributes to these pathways indicating its importance in cellular growth and division.

GAS41 is linked to glioma progression and certain neurodegenerative disorders. Changes in the expression of GAS41 have been observed in gliomas connecting it with the uncontrolled cell growth characteristic of these tumors. Through its association with other proteins like ATRX GAS41 is implicated in chromatin remodeling disturbances seen in neurodegenerative diseases influencing gene expression patterns and contributing to disease pathogenesis.

General info

Function

Chromatin reader component of the NuA4 histone acetyltransferase (HAT) complex, a complex involved in transcriptional activation of select genes principally by acetylation of nucleosomal histones H4 and H2A (PubMed : 12963728, PubMed : 14966270). Specifically recognizes and binds acylated histone H3, with a preference for histone H3 diacetylated at 'Lys-18' and 'Lys-27' (H3K18ac and H3K27ac) or histone H3 diacetylated at 'Lys-14' and 'Lys-27' (H3K14ac and H3K27ac) (PubMed : 29437725, PubMed : 29900004, PubMed : 30071723). Also able to recognize and bind crotonylated histone H3 (PubMed : 30071723). May also recognize and bind histone H3 succinylated at 'Lys-122' (H3K122succ); additional evidences are however required to confirm this result in vivo (PubMed : 29463709). Plays a key role in histone variant H2AZ1/H2A.Z deposition into specific chromatin regions : recognizes and binds H3K14ac and H3K27ac on the promoters of actively transcribed genes and recruits NuA4-related complex to deposit H2AZ1/H2A.Z (PubMed : 29437725). H2AZ1/H2A.Z deposition is required for maintenance of embryonic stem cell (By similarity).

Subcellular localisation

Nucleus
